Henry Jamess The Ambassadors is a masterfully crafted exploration of identity and morality in the expatriate context of early 20th-century Europe The novel follows Lambert Strether an American envoy sent to Paris to retrieve the wayward son of a wealthy industrialist Through its intricate narrative style characterized by Jamess hallmark psychological depth and complex character development the readers are drawn into an examination of the contrast...
